Skip to main content

Careers

BMA is an innovative company that cares about each individual
employee as well as its clients. We value teamwork and
collaboration, and are constantly looking for positive, passionate
people to join our team.

Learn more about what it’s like to work at BMA below.

View Open PositionsView Open Positions

About Our Departments

Our Development Group works hard to keep BMA at the forefront of changes in the financial industry. We are always looking for skilled PHP developers who can support our next-generation web-based product.

Applicants must have 1+ years of experience with PHP and an understanding of HTML, CSS, JavaScript, MVC, API and SQL. Experience with jQuery and IBM DB2 database is also a plus.

Development Group personnel duties include:

  • Design, develop, and maintain software developed in PHP
  • Convert legacy reports to modern PDF reports
  • Convert UIs to web-based applications

Superior client service is a cornerstone of BMA. It is a primary reason why new clients choose to partner with us, and what encourages them to continue the partnership.

We empower our client service account executives to assist our clients in a professional and efficient manner. Our executives develop close, friendly relationships with clients, and they actively cross-sell additional services.

Customer Service Team duties include:

  • Act as a front-line liaison for all departments within BMA
  • Promptly resolve customer questions and problems
  • Properly refer and coordinate projects
  • Be courteous
  • Prepare and conduct customer training sessions
  • Complete related records, reports, and documents

BMA actively updates our system to maintain the most efficient processes. In order to deliver quality software and service, our Quality Assurance (QA) Department regularly performs rigorous operational and performance tests. They conduct the highest level of testing in the industry on all system software. This is a vital area for the success of BMA.

The duties of our QA team include:

  • Plan and develop test scenarios
  • Analyze and interpret test data and documents
  • Track and resolve issues and problems
  • Document all testing processes and results
  • Analyze, test, and train the Product Team (Including Account Executives, Operations, Internal Audit, Product Management, Sales/Marketing, Security, and the BMA President) on updated request changes and, if applicable, competitors’ products and/or services as identified

BMA provides backroom operation services for our financial partners. Our Operations Department oversees computer-related processes to keep everything running smoothly.

The duties of our Operations team include:

  • Accurately perform data entry functions
  • Produce required reports and records
  • Operate computers and peripheral equipment
  • Assist other operators as required
  • Maintain activity logs 
  • Perform minor preventive maintenance on equipment

Perks & Benefits of Working at BMA

Unique, Strong Work Culture

Unique, strong work culture

Forward Thinking

A forward-thinking company

Team Management

Management is knowledgeable, but willing to listen to others

Input Appreciation

Input appreciated and considered from all levels and departments

Lunches and Activities

Frequent company lunches and activities

Competitive Pay

Competitive pay

Relaxed Atmosphere

Relaxed yet business-like atmosphere

Health insurance, IRA’s and 401K’s

Health insurance, IRA’s and 401K’s

Join the Team!

To view open positions and apply, visit:

Our Open PositionsOur Open Positions